YNW Melly is facing the death penalty in connection with the deaths of his childhood friends, YNW Sakchaser and YNW Juvy. He pleaded not guilty to the charges back in March.

Melly's attorney has argued there is "very little actual evidence" against the rapper. His team also said there is a lack of witnesses and "no indication" of a murder motive.
